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ls Ingredients
For the Filling
- Egg Roll/Spring Roll Wrappers – Structure and hold the filling; use Dynasty brand for larger size, avoiding wonton wrappers.
- Shredded Cooked Chicken Breast – The main protein component; opt for rotisserie chicken for convenience.
- Buffalo Sauce – Provides flavor and heat; adjust quantity to taste for spice preference.
- Cream Cheese – Adds creaminess and acts as a binding agent; ensure it’s softened for easy mixing.
- Warm Melted Butter – Adds richness; can substitute with olive oil for a lighter option.
- Dry Ranch Seasoning Mix – Enhances flavor profile; use more or less based on your preference.
- Chopped Scallions – Contributes freshness and crunch; use both green and white parts for maximum flavor.
- Celery – Adds texture and crunch; dice finely to blend well with the filling.
- Freshly Shredded Pepper Jack Cheese – Melts beautifully and adds spiciness; Colby Jack can be swapped for a milder flavor.
- Freshly Shredded Cheddar Cheese – Delivers additional flavor and creaminess; any other melty cheese can work in its place.
- Salt and Pepper – Enhances the overall flavor; adjust to taste as necessary.
For Frying and Serving
- Vegetable or Canola Oil – Required for frying; use your preferred oil for the method.
- Water – Essential as a sealing agent for the wrappers; prevents unwrapping during cooking.
- Ranch Dressing and Buffalo Sauce – Perfect dipping sauces; optional mixing of ranch with blue cheese can add flavor complexity.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ls
Step 1: Prepare the Filling
Start by mixing the shredded cooked chicken, buffalo sauce, softened cream cheese, warm melted butter, dry ranch seasoning mix, chopped scallions, diced celery, and both shredded cheeses in a large bowl. Use a spatula to combine until the mixture is thick and creamy, ensuring every ingredient is evenly distributed. This delightful filling is the heart of your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ls, packed with flavor!
Step 2: Assemble the Egg Rolls
lay out an egg roll wrapper on a clean surface with one corner facing you. Spoon about 1.5 tablespoons of the prepared filling onto the wrapper’s center, then fold the bottom corner over the filling. Tightly roll the wrapper away from you, folding in the sides as you go, and seal the edges with a little water. Repeat this process until all the filling is used up, ensuring each is tightly rolled to prevent leakage.
Step 3: Heat the Oil
In a large skillet, pour in vegetable or canola oil to a depth of about 2 inches and heat it over medium-high heat. Use a thermometer to monitor the oil temperature, aiming for 325-350°F (165-175°C). This range is crucial for achieving that perfect crispiness in your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ls. Once the oil reaches the desired temperature, you’re ready to fry!
Step 4: Fry the Egg Rolls
Carefully place a few assembled egg rolls into the hot oil, making sure not to overcrowd the skillet. Cook them for 4-5 minutes on each side, or until they turn a beautiful golden brown and are crispy. Use a slotted spoon to turn them gently to ensure even cooking. Once done, transfer the fried egg rolls to a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.

How to Store and Freeze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ls
Fridge: Store cooked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ven to restore their crispiness.
Freezer: For longer storage, freeze uncooked egg rolls on a baking sheet until firm, then transfer to a freezer bag or container. They can be kept for up to 3 months.
Reheating: When ready to enjoy, fry or bake directly from frozen. If baking, add a few extra minutes to the cooking time to ensure they are heated through and crispy.
Make-Ahead Tips: Assemble the egg rolls and refrigerate uncooked for up to 24 hours before frying or baking them for a fresh treat at your gathering.
Expert Tips for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ls
Use Fresh Wrappers: Ensure your egg roll wrappers are fresh and pliable; stale or dried ones may crack and lead to poor sealing during frying.
Thick Filling: Make sure your filling is thick; a runny mixture may seep out while frying, creating a mess instead of perfectly crispy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ls.
Oil Temperature: Maintain the oil temperature between 325-350°F (165-175°C) for optimal frying; too cool will yield soggy rolls, while too hot can burn them.
Seal Well: Use a little water to seal the edges securely; this prevents the filling from leaking out during cooking, ensuring a delicious, intact bite.
Reheat Smartly: If you have leftovers, avoid microwaving them, as this will soften their crispy exterior. Instead, reheat in the oven or air fryer for the best results.

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ls Recipe FAQs
How do I choose the right egg roll wrappers?
Absolutely! When selecting egg roll wrappers, I recommend using the Dynasty brand as they are larger and provide better structure for these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ls. Avoid wonton wrappers, as they are too small and fragile, leading to potential tearing during assembly.
How should I store leftover egg rolls?
Very! After cooking, place your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ls in an airtight container and store them in the fridge for up to 3 days. To maintain their crispiness when reheating, I’d suggest popping them in the oven at 375°F (190°C) for about 10-15 minutes until heated through.
Can I freeze Buffalo Chicken Egg Rolls?
Absolutely! To freeze, lay the uncooked egg rolls on a baking sheet in a single layer until they are firm, then transfer them to a freezer bag or container. They can be stored for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y, fry or bake them straight from the freezer, adding a few extra minutes to the cooking time to ensure they are cooked thoroughly.
What should I do if the filling leaks during frying?
Don’t worry! If your filling leaks, it may be because the mixture was too runny or the edges weren’t sealed properly. Ensure that your filling is thick before assembling, and use enough water to securely seal the edges of the wrappers. If it happens, just adjust your technique for the next batch and be sure to monitor the temperature of the oil!
